You want drama? How about a wry, Tony Award-winning tale of lessons learned? Mill Valley has both this weekend and into September, as theater dominates the slate of local events

Into the Woods, the acclaimed Stephen Sondheim musical, gets a treatment from the Marin Youth Performers, 142 Throckmorton Theatre's youth division. Director Joan Deamer helms a production that features many of her former pupils. Go here for the full story, here for more info and here to see an excerpt from a preview show earlier this month.

Further up Throckmorton Ave., Curtain Theatre is going old school with "As You Like It," the Shakespeare play it performed in its first year as part of Mill Valley's millennium celebration in 2000. As always, the Curtain's shows are free and under the redwoods in the Old Mill amphitheater. Go here for more info.

Also on the docket is the Marin Conservation League's walk through Marin conservation history with a tour of the Marincello development, which was defeated in 1970. And if worm composting is more your thing, Tam Valley Community Center has you covered.
